Overview

The fund is an investment vehicle that dedicates at least 80% of its net assets to investing in FLexible EXchange® Options (FLEX Options) that are tied to the SPDR® S&P 500® ETF Trust (the "Underlying ETF"). FLEX Options are distinguished by their exchange-traded nature and the ability to have their terms customized to fit specific investor needs. Unlike many investment funds that aim to diversify their holdings across a broad range of assets, this fund adopts a non-diversified approach, concentrating its investments in FLEX Options related to a specific underlying ETF, thereby offering a focused investment strategy.

Products and Services

The fund specializes in providing investment opportunities through:

  • FLexible EXchange® Options (FLEX Options):

    FLEX Options are innovative financial instruments that allow for the exchange-trading of options contracts with customizable terms. This customization can include aspects like the expiration date, strike price, and the underlying assets, among others. The fund capitalizes on these features to provide a tailored investment approach that aligns with its strategic objectives and risk management.

  • SPDR® S&P 500® ETF Trust-Based Investment:

    The primary focus of the fund's investments is on FLEX Options that reference the SPDR® S&P 500® ETF Trust, which is one of the most well-known ETFs tracking the performance of the S&P 500 Index. This strategy leverages the underlying ETF's exposure to the broad U.S. equity market, aiming to reflect its performance while employing the unique benefits offered by FLEX Options.
